Overview

Flame-proof board, also known as fireproof board, is a specialized building material designed to resist high temperatures and prevent the spread of fire. It is commonly used in commercial and industrial construction to enhance safety and comply with fire regulations. The board is available in various materials, including gypsum, cement, and mineral wool, each offering different levels of fire resistance and insulation. Due to its lightweight and durable nature, flame-proof board is easy to install and integrate into various construction projects. It is often used for cladding, partitions, and ceilings, providing both functional and aesthetic benefits. The material's fire-resistant properties make it a critical component in buildings where fire safety is a priority.

Structure and Working Principle

Flame-proof boards are engineered with fire-resistant cores and protective layers to withstand extreme heat. The core material, such as gypsum or mineral wool, is treated with additives that expand when exposed to heat, forming an insulating barrier. This barrier slows down the transfer of heat and prevents the spread of flames. The outer layers of the board are often reinforced with fiberglass or other materials to enhance durability and structural integrity. When installed correctly, the board creates a fire-resistant barrier that can contain fires for a specified period, allowing occupants to evacuate safely. The working principle relies on the material's ability to absorb heat and maintain its structural stability under high temperatures.

Key Features

Flame-proof boards offer several key features that make them ideal for fire-resistant construction. These include high fire resistance ratings, often exceeding 60 minutes of protection, depending on the material and thickness. The boards also provide excellent thermal insulation, reducing heat transfer and protecting adjacent structures. Additionally, flame-proof boards are lightweight and easy to handle, simplifying installation and reducing labor costs. They are also compatible with other building materials, such as steel and wood, making them versatile for various applications. Some boards are designed to be moisture-resistant, further enhancing their durability and suitability for different environments.

Application Areas

Flame-proof boards are widely used in commercial and industrial buildings, including offices, hospitals, schools, and factories. They are particularly valuable in areas with high fire risk, such as kitchens, electrical rooms, and storage facilities. The boards are also used in public spaces like theaters and shopping malls to ensure compliance with fire safety regulations. In residential construction, flame-proof boards are increasingly used for added safety, especially in multi-family housing and high-rise buildings. Their aesthetic appeal and ease of installation make them a popular choice for modern construction projects. The boards can be painted or finished to match the design requirements of the space.

Maintenance and Precautions

To maintain the fire-resistant properties of flame-proof boards, regular inspections and proper maintenance are essential. Ensure that the boards are free from damage, such as cracks or holes, which can compromise their effectiveness. Any damaged sections should be repaired or replaced immediately. During installation, it is crucial to follow the manufacturer's guidelines to ensure a proper seal and fit. Gaps or improper sealing can reduce the board's fire resistance. Additionally, avoid exposing the boards to excessive moisture or chemicals that may degrade their performance. Proper storage before installation is also important to prevent damage.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ring flame-proof boards for B2B purposes, consider factors such as fire rating, thickness, and material compatibility. Verify the product's certifications and compliance with local fire safety standards. It is also important to assess the supplier's reputation and reliability to ensure consistent quality. Request samples and test the boards for performance under simulated fire conditions if possible. Compare prices from multiple suppliers, but prioritize quality and compliance over cost. Establish long-term relationships with suppliers to ensure timely delivery and support for large projects. Bulk purchasing may offer cost savings, but ensure that storage conditions are suitable to maintain the boards' integrity.
